    Re: Arena Combat

    If you're not in combat, you're...not in combat. Doesn't matter where you are.

    It would be pretty unfair for mana classes to not be able to drink, considering melee (who run arena anyway) have infinite resources to keep fighting. Don't argue that ret pallys and enh shaman use mana; they can still auto attack and be more useful than a caster who is OOM. Besides, if you let any caster get out of combat long enough to drink, thats your own fault. NE druids are the only ones that I can see getting away to drink easily, but be smart and keep a dot or bleed on them so you can see them.

    Re: Arena Combat

    I think OP might be on to something ... healers are pretty overpowered in 2v2 right now right?


    Seriously I play a healer and dispise the need to drink in arenas. I feel it cheapens any skill or effort at mana management and turns mana management from understanding your class and spell selection to glorified hide and seek. Remove drain mechanics, and remove drinking and I think arenas would be a much better place. Even if they just nerfed viper sting I could see giving up drinking in arenas .. give that bastard a cast time, a short cooldown (the duration of the current drain), and put the drain up front so we stand a chance of regening enough to cast something between drains.
